### ScaleSpoon 4.2 — changed defaults

Support: heads up. Rounding now defaults to nearest-quarter instead of nearest-eighth, and metric output is on by default. Users on pinned configs are unaffected; everyone else sees the new behavior after upgrade. Expect tickets about "wrong" fractions. The new defaults shipped in 4.2 are listed below for reference.

deployment values, fafog-fawip:
[jorox]
team = fendor
access_code = ac_bb00ea
host = jorox.qorveltech.internal
port = 9200
owner = istdor.aldeth
peer = julvan.orvexlabs.internal

## Hayrick Gateway — Telemetry Restart

Welcome aboard! The Hayrick gateway collects telemetry from combines and seeders in the Dunmore test fields. If units stop reporting, first check the MQTT bridge — it's the usual culprit. Restart it with `hayrick-bridge restart`, then watch the ingest counter for two minutes. If packets flow but nothing lands in the dashboard, the writer process has lost its handle to the telemetry store. Reconnect it manually to verify the store is reachable. Use the following for that.

replica DSN, yahog-kawig: redis://istox_svc:um@db-8a67.halixforge.test:5432/frawyn

Schema Registry Recovery — Fenwick Eventworks

If the registry admin account for Pylon (our event schema registry) is locked, do not re-register schemas manually; compatibility checks will break. Restore access first. Open the recovery console on the standby node, select the pylon-admin identity, and choose passphrase recovery. Producers can keep publishing against cached schemas for up to 30 minutes. Confirm registry health before re-enabling validation. Enter the recovery passphrase exactly as written below.

vault phrase of tawig-taduf = zorath-oliwyn

Welcome to on-call for WideDiff, our diff viewer for large files. Most pages involve the chunking service falling behind; restart it via the runbook and verify the queue drains. Deploys go through the Harrowfield pipeline and every artifact must be signed or the viewer nodes reject it. If you need to push an emergency build yourself, sign it locally first. The current deploy key is as follows.

signing key of bagap-yawep = bky13_TbfT6ZMUoGJo2